Key Takeaways
- Exceptional reliability with zero reported recalls or consumer complaints.
- Competent handling and a comfortable ride for daily commuting.
- Generous standard features, including safety technologies like forward-collision and lane-departure warning.
- Practical hatchback utility with versatile cargo space.

Who This Car Is For
Best for
Budget-conscious individuals or families seeking a dependable and practical hatchback for daily commuting and general use.
+1 more buyer-fit notes in the full report
Avoid if
Drivers who demand strong acceleration, sporty driving dynamics, or the latest in infotainment technology.
